This 500 gm pack of Lactose Broth is a high-quality microbiological medium designed for cultivating coliform bacteria in food, water, and dairy samples. It offers consistent results in both presumptive coliform testing and general microbial analysis. Easy to prepare and sterilize, this dehydrated culture medium is essential in water quality testing and food safety labs. It complies with standard protocols for microbial detection and quality assurance.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Question: What is Lactose Broth used for?
Answer: Lactose Broth is used for the detection and cultivation of coliform bacteria in food, water, and dairy samples.
Question: How do I prepare Lactose Broth for testing?
Answer: Dissolve the required amount in distilled water, sterilize by autoclaving at 121°C for 15 minutes, and cool before use.
Question: What is the shelf life of this product?
Answer: The typical shelf life is 2-3 years if stored properly in a cool, dry place.
Question: Is this product suitable for potable water testing?
Answer: Yes, it is commonly used in water quality testing for coliform bacteria, including potable water.
Question: Can this broth be used for confirmatory tests?
Answer: Lactose Broth is primarily for presumptive testing. Confirmatory tests require additional specific media like Brilliant Green Bile Broth.
